.archive .page_hero__meta,.archive .post_item_meta{margin-bottom:16px;display:flex;align-items:center;flex-wrap:wrap;gap:12px}.archive .page_hero__category,.archive .post_item_meta_category{padding:3px 12px;display:flex;align-items:center;justify-content:center;font-weight:600;line-height:138%;border-radius:96px;background-color:rgba(16,16,18,.05)}.archive .book_demo_block{background:#f6f6f6}.archive .book_demo_block .logotypes_slider:after{background:linear-gradient(90deg,rgba(246,246,246,0) 0,rgba(246,246,246,.5) 100%),linear-gradient(270deg,#f6f6f6 0,rgba(246,246,246,0) 100%)}.archive .book_demo_block .logotypes_slider:before{background:linear-gradient(270deg,rgba(246,246,246,0) 0,rgba(246,246,246,.5) 100%),linear-gradient(90deg,#f6f6f6 0,rgba(246,246,246,0) 100%)}.posts_filter{margin-bottom:56px;display:flex;gap:12px}@media only screen and (max-width:834px){.posts_filter{margin-bottom:40px}}@media only screen and (max-width:576px){.posts_filter.desktop{display:none}}.posts_filter.mobile{display:none}@media only screen and (max-width:576px){.posts_filter.mobile{display:block}}.posts_filter .filter-button{padding:11.5px 20px;-webkit-appearance:none;outline:0;display:flex;align-items:center;justify-content:center;line-height:138%;font-weight:700;color:#101012;border-radius:100px;border:1px solid rgba(16,16,18,.1);cursor:pointer;transition:all ease-in-out .35s}.posts_filter .filter-button.active{background-color:#101012;color:#fff}.posts_filter .filter-select{position:relative}.posts_filter .filter-select.open .filter-options{max-height:384px;box-shadow:0 0 24px 0 rgba(0,0,0,.04),0 32px 64px 0 rgba(0,0,0,.03),0 12px 47px 0 rgba(0,0,0,.04),0 6px 26px 0 rgba(0,0,0,.05)}.posts_filter .filter-select.open .filter-arrow{transform:rotate(-180deg)}.posts_filter .filter-arrow{transition:all ease-in-out .35s}.posts_filter .filter-selected-wrap{display:flex;align-items:center;justify-content:space-between;padding:13px 12px 13px 16px;font-size:14px;line-height:136%;font-weight:700;border-radius:6px;border:1px solid rgba(0,0,0,.1)}.posts_filter .filter-options{max-height:0;background:#fff;border-radius:8px;box-shadow:none;overflow-x:clip;overflow-y:auto;position:absolute;top:calc(100% + 8px);height:auto;left:0;right:0;z-index:21;transition:all ease-in-out .35s}.posts_filter .filter-option{padding:13px 16px;font-size:16px;line-height:138%;font-weight:600;transition:all ease-in-out .35s}.posts_filter .filter-option.active{background-color:#101012;font-weight:700;color:#fff}.page_hero{background:#fff;padding-top:180px;padding-bottom:104px}@media only screen and (max-width:1024px){.page_hero{padding-top:156px;padding-bottom:64px;max-width:none}}@media only screen and (max-width:576px){.page_hero{padding-top:124px}}.page_hero.article .page_hero__inner{padding:0}.page_hero.article .page_hero__media{padding:0;max-width:592px;aspect-ratio:148/103}@media only screen and (max-width:834px){.page_hero.article .page_hero__media{max-width:none;aspect-ratio:181/120}}.page_hero.article .page_hero__content{max-width:552px}@media only screen and (max-width:834px){.page_hero.article .page_hero__content{max-width:none}}.page_hero.reverse .page_hero__inner{flex-direction:row-reverse}@media only screen and (max-width:834px){.page_hero.reverse .page_hero__inner{flex-direction:column-reverse}}.page_hero__read-time{color:rgba(0,0,0,.6)}.page_hero__text{font-weight:400;color:rgba(16,16,18,.8)}.page_hero__media{max-width:435px;width:100%;aspect-ratio:475/504;border-radius:10px;overflow:hidden}@media only screen and (max-width:834px){.page_hero__media{max-width:none;padding:0}}.page_hero__image{display:block;width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.page_hero__content{padding:12px;max-width:564px;width:100%}@media only screen and (max-width:834px){.page_hero__content{max-width:none;padding:0}}.page_hero__logo{margin-bottom:32px}@media only screen and (max-width:834px){.page_hero__logo{margin-bottom:24px}}.page_hero__logo img,.page_hero__logo svg{max-width:100%;max-height:24px;height:auto;-o-object-fit:contain;object-fit:contain;-o-object-position:0 0;object-position:0 0;display:block}.page_hero__inner{gap:72px}@media only screen and (max-width:834px){.page_hero__inner{flex-direction:column;gap:28px}}.page_hero__title{margin-bottom:16px}@media only screen and (max-width:834px){.page_hero__title{font-size:32px}}.page_hero__link{margin-top:32px;display:flex;align-items:center;gap:12px;font-size:16px;font-weight:500;color:#202127}.page_hero__link svg{transition:all ease-in-out .35s}.page_hero .post_item_category{padding:3px 10px}.works_archive_inner .posts_works{display:grid;grid-template-columns:repeat(3,1fr);gap:72px 34px}@media only screen and (max-width:1024px){.works_archive_inner .posts_works{grid-template-columns:repeat(2,1fr);gap:32px}}@media only screen and (max-width:576px){.works_archive_inner .posts_works{grid-template-columns:1fr}}.works_archive_inner .post_item{gap:28px;transition:all .4s}@media only screen and (max-width:834px){.works_archive_inner .post_item{width:100%;gap:24px}}.works_archive_inner .post_item:hover img{transform:scale(1.104)}.works_archive_inner .post_item:hover .arrow{transform:rotate(-45deg)}.works_archive_inner .title_block_item{flex:1}.works_archive_inner .title_item{color:rgba(16,16,18,.8)}.works_archive_inner .subtitle_item{color:rgba(16,16,18,.8)}.works_archive_inner .img_block_item{margin-top:auto;width:100%;position:relative;overflow:hidden;border-radius:4px;box-shadow:0 8px 80px 0 rgba(17,16,27,.08);aspect-ratio:184/205}.works_archive_inner .img_block_item img{position:absolute;top:0;left:0;display:block;width:100%;height:100%;-o-object-fit:cover;object-fit:cover;transition:all ease-in-out .4s}.works_archive_inner .img_block_item .arrow{height:48px;width:48px;background-color:#fff;border-radius:100%;position:absolute;right:16px;bottom:16px;z-index:2;transition:all .4s}.works_archive_inner .img_block_item .arrow svg{transition:all .4s}.works_archive .works_archive_inner{overflow-x:clip;padding-top:220px;padding-bottom:112px;background:#f9f9f9}@media only screen and (max-width:1024px){.works_archive .works_archive_inner{padding-top:190px;padding-bottom:100px}}@media only screen and (max-width:834px){.works_archive .works_archive_inner{padding-top:172px;padding-bottom:72px}}.works_archive .works_archive_title{margin-bottom:80px}@media only screen and (max-width:1024px){.works_archive .works_archive_title{margin-bottom:64px}}@media only screen and (max-width:834px){.works_archive .works_archive_title{margin-bottom:40px}}@media only screen and (max-width:576px){.works_archive .works_archive_title{margin-bottom:32px}}.works_archive .posts_filter{flex-wrap:wrap}@media only screen and (max-width:1024px){.works_archive .posts_filter{margin-right:0}}@media only screen and (max-width:834px){.works_archive .posts_filter{margin-bottom:40px}}@media only screen and (max-width:576px){.works_archive .posts_filter{overflow:visible}}.works_archive .posts_works{gap:56px}@media only screen and (max-width:1024px){.works_archive .posts_works{gap:40px}}@media only screen and (max-width:834px){.works_archive .posts_works{gap:48px}}.works_archive .title_block_item{padding-bottom:40px}@media only screen and (max-width:1024px){.works_archive .title_block_item{padding-bottom:32px}}@media only screen and (max-width:834px){.works_archive .title_block_item{padding-bottom:0}}.works_archive .title_item{font-size:16px;line-height:150%;margin-bottom:8px;color:rgba(0,0,0,.6)}.works_archive .subtitle_item{margin-bottom:16px}.works_archive .subtitle_item:last-child{margin-bottom:0}.works_archive .work_tags{display:flex;flex-wrap:wrap;gap:6px}.works_archive .work_tags_item{padding:6px 13px;height:34px;border-radius:120px;border:1px solid rgba(0,0,0,.2);font-size:14px;font-weight:600;line-height:136%;color:rgba(16,16,18,.8)}.articles_archive .articles_archive_inner{background-color:#fff;padding-top:0;padding-bottom:120px}@media only screen and (max-width:834px){.articles_archive .articles_archive_inner{padding-bottom:72px}}.articles_archive .articles_archive_inner .content_block{padding-top:72px;position:relative}@media only screen and (max-width:834px){.articles_archive .articles_archive_inner .content_block{padding-top:40px}}.articles_archive .articles_archive_inner .content_block:before{content:"";position:absolute;top:0;left:24px;right:24px;height:1px;background-color:rgba(0,0,0,.1)}.articles_archive .articles_archive_inner .title_block{gap:32px}.articles_archive .articles_archive_inner .subtitle{width:584px;max-width:100%}.articles_archive .posts_works{gap:64px 32px}.articles_archive .title_block_item{padding:20px 16px 12px}@media only screen and (max-width:834px){.articles_archive .title_block_item{padding:16px 12px 8px}}.articles_archive .post_item{box-shadow:none;border-radius:0;gap:0}.articles_archive .post_item_meta{margin-bottom:12px}.articles_archive .post_item_meta_time{color:rgba(0,0,0,.6)}.articles_archive .img_block_item{border-radius:4px;aspect-ratio:192/127}.articles_archive .title_item{margin-bottom:8px;font-size:22px;font-weight:800;line-height:138%}.articles_archive .title_item:last-child{margin-bottom:0}.articles_archive .subtitle_item{display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;color:rgba(0,0,0,.7)}@media only screen and (max-width:834px){.articles_archive .posts_works{gap:40px}}.load-more-wrapper{margin-top:56px;display:flex;justify-content:center}.load-more-wrapper .load-more-button{max-width:240px;width:100%}.load-more-wrapper .load-more-button.loading{pointer-events:none;background-color:#101012;color:#fff;opacity:.6}.posts_pagination{margin-top:56px;display:flex;align-items:center;justify-content:center}.posts_pagination .page-numbers{display:flex;align-items:center;justify-content:center;width:48px;height:48px;font-size:18px;font-weight:700;line-height:133%;border-radius:50%;transition:all ease-in-out .3s}.posts_pagination .page-numbers.current{background-color:#101012;color:#fff}.posts_pagination .page-numbers.next,.posts_pagination .page-numbers.prev{background:rgba(0,0,0,.05);-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px)}.posts_works{position:relative}.posts_works.loading:before{opacity:1;pointer-events:auto}.posts_works:before{content:"";position:absolute;top:-24px;left:-24px;right:-24px;bottom:-24px;background-color:rgba(255,255,255,.1);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);opacity:0;pointer-events:none;z-index:20;transition:all ease-in-out .35s}
/*# sourceMappingURL=archive_works.css.map */
